diff options
author | sbz <sbz@FreeBSD.org> | 2012-07-10 19:22:59 +0800 |
---|---|---|
committer | sbz <sbz@FreeBSD.org> | 2012-07-10 19:22:59 +0800 |
commit | f79ca8e22ab7e3b5e44ad45f48fcbdc26398ef1c (patch) | |
tree | d2ec6873783814a587d94fb90391477d51d31729 /sysutils | |
parent | 20491c0e009b522ea00fa4aa7002c10a8e36b614 (diff) | |
download | freebsd-ports-gnome-f79ca8e22ab7e3b5e44ad45f48fcbdc26398ef1c.tar.gz freebsd-ports-gnome-f79ca8e22ab7e3b5e44ad45f48fcbdc26398ef1c.tar.zst freebsd-ports-gnome-f79ca8e22ab7e3b5e44ad45f48fcbdc26398ef1c.zip |
- Fix build with clang [1]
- Add LICENSE
- Make portlint happy
PR: ports/168838
Submitted by: Oliver Hartmann <ohartman at zedat.fu-berlin.de> [1]
Approved by: myself (maintainer)
Diffstat (limited to 'sysutils')
-rw-r--r-- | sysutils/ldapvi/Makefile | 16 | ||||
-rw-r--r-- | sysutils/ldapvi/files/patch-ldapvi.c | 11 |
2 files changed, 20 insertions, 7 deletions
diff --git a/sysutils/ldapvi/Makefile b/sysutils/ldapvi/Makefile index 76444acb6641..d4e200737eb1 100644 --- a/sysutils/ldapvi/Makefile +++ b/sysutils/ldapvi/Makefile @@ -9,12 +9,16 @@ PORTNAME= ldapvi PORTVERSION= 1.7 PORTREVISION= 3 CATEGORIES= sysutils net -MASTER_SITES= http://www.lichteblau.com/download/ +MASTER_SITES= http://www.lichteblau.com/download/ \ + ${MASTER_SITE_LOCAL:S,%SUBDIR%,sbz,} MAINTAINER= sbz@FreeBSD.org COMMENT= A tool to update LDAP entries with a text editor -LIB_DEPENDS= popt.0:${PORTSDIR}/devel/popt +LICENSE= GPLv2 +LICENSE_FILE= ${WRKSRC}/COPYING + +LIB_DEPENDS= popt:${PORTSDIR}/devel/popt USE_OPENLDAP= yes USE_GNOME= pkgconfig glib20 @@ -27,16 +31,14 @@ CFLAGS+= -I${LOCALBASE}/include CPPFLAGS+= -I${LOCALBASE}/include LDFLAGS+= -L${LOCALBASE}/lib -MAN1= ldapvi.1 -PLIST_FILES= bin/ldapvi \ +MAN1= ${PORTNAME}.1 +PLIST_FILES= bin/${PORTNAME} \ ${DOCSDIR_REL}/manual.css ${DOCSDIR_REL}/manual.xml \ ${DOCSDIR_REL}/bg.png ${DOCSDIR_REL}/html.xsl PLIST_DIRS= ${DOCSDIR_REL} -.include <bsd.port.pre.mk> - .if !defined(WANT_OPENLDAP_SASL) || defined(WITHOUT_SASL) CONFIGURE_ARGS+=--without-sasl .endif -.include <bsd.port.post.mk> +.include <bsd.port.mk> diff --git a/sysutils/ldapvi/files/patch-ldapvi.c b/sysutils/ldapvi/files/patch-ldapvi.c new file mode 100644 index 000000000000..1939f9a11aed --- /dev/null +++ b/sysutils/ldapvi/files/patch-ldapvi.c @@ -0,0 +1,11 @@ +--- ./ldapvi.c.orig 2012-07-09 23:43:28.000000000 +0200 ++++ ./ldapvi.c 2012-07-09 23:43:50.000000000 +0200 +@@ -1465,7 +1465,7 @@ + int line = 0; + int c; + +- if (lstat(sasl, &st) == -1) return; ++ if (lstat(sasl, &st) == -1) return 0; + if ( !(in = fopen(sasl, "r"))) syserr(); + + if (st.st_size > 0) { |